A girl around 15 years old has died after a serious traffic accident at Södervärn in Malmö on Friday afternoon. A man in his 40s has been arrested on suspicion of gross causing of another’s death and gross negligence in traffic.

The alarm came in around 3:30 PM and several police patrols, ambulances, and rescue units were dispatched to the scene. The accident occurred in one of Malmö’s busiest areas during the afternoon rush hour.

Many people were present in the area when the accident happened, and several witnesses saw the incident. According to reports from the scene, the girl was hit while crossing a pedestrian crossing.

Witnesses describe how a car came speeding and then hit the girl before additional vehicles collided in a chain crash.

Police announced later in the evening that the girl had died from her injuries in the hospital. Another person was also taken to hospital after the accident.

The driver of the car, a man in his 40s, was arrested shortly after the incident. He is now suspected of gross causing of another’s death and gross negligence in traffic.
